Growing cannabis outdoors has many advantages, as outdoor crops get more sunlight, air, and space to grow than indoor plants. Consequently, outdoor cannabis crops can double the size and yield of indoor crops.
However, getting a great yield from your plant depends on the health of your cannabis plants (as without the right nutrients, cannabis plants won’t flower). How do you increase yield outdoors?
The best way to increase your yield outdoors is by meticulously monitoring your plant’s health. To keep your plants healthy, test your soil and water quality regularly, supplement your plant’s nutrients with fertilizer, and keep an eye out for plant-eating pests like aphids and fungus gnats.
